Abosede Oluwaseun, aide to the Minister of Interior and former Governor of Osun State, Rauf Aregbesola has narrated his ordeal in the hands of suspected armed robbers.

Abosede, a staunch member of the Osun Progressives (TOP), told Journalists on Friday, Aug. 27, that his residence located at Dada Estate in Osogbo, Osun was besieged by five masked men. According to him, the men who wielded assault rifles invaded his house on Thursday night.

He said that the robbers ordered him to transfer all the money he had into his wife’s account, after which they took away  his wife’s ATM card.

Narrating what happened, he said that the men gained entry into his compound by jumping the fence. He said they then entered through the kitchen door as his wife was about to close it.

He said that the armed hoodlums threatened to kill him and his wife. He said, both of them were later tied up and mercilessly beaten with a machete. He said that he sustained a cut during the beating.

He added, “while all this was happening, the security features on my phone were deactivated and all the money I have, I transferred in to my wife’s account. The armed robbers carted away with my wife’s ATM card.”

After the operation, he explained that the armed men entered his Toyota Camry and drove off. He however, said that the car was later recovered early Friday morning with the number plates detached.

Meanwhile, the Police Public Relations Officer in Osun State, CSP Yemisi Opalola confirmed the attack. She said that Abosede reported the case to the Dada Estate Police Station, and that his car was recovered afterwards.
